The following is a demonstration of BikeCAD for the Web. BikeCAD for the Web allows builders to post their own customized version of BikeCAD on their own web site.
Notice how launching Joe's Design Center automatically defaults to one of Joe's own bikes. The menus have also been stripped down so that Joe's customers can only select from options that Joe wants them to. There is a button in the file menu that allows customers to e-mail their designs directly to Joe. Joe can set up as many starting templates as he wants. Each template can be customized through the files fit_advisor.xml, forks.xml, wheels.xml, properties.xml and template.bcad.
